Output fba6232a1568296309cd6065424fe35d74d72e60d1d7cd6c12ca4c20e534c437:139

value
4066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b0aa780fbdb92f6ebc194082b80bf14f45f312 OP_EQUAL
address
34fsBeJEeFTCVv8cTHoKiBACbRkg6RpcAe
transaction
fba6232a1568296309cd6065424fe35d74d72e60d1d7cd6c12ca4c20e534c437
spent
true